Output bf68d521541d0f77844a1ac77b68529c1add50126fe20a156bd15ce25df2ec57:8

value
59500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bafb3bf588d7d83bad10e60961cf5a2a2d9861ca OP_EQUAL
address
3JjgaHQ1CYdjXVCQJKna3fM6NqWQmbJcrR
transaction
bf68d521541d0f77844a1ac77b68529c1add50126fe20a156bd15ce25df2ec57
spent
true